Number of Respondents Who Use No Tools5 Sci (N=99) Eng (87) CS (199) Math (24) Other (39) All (448) fix serial program 42% 38% 40% 38% 33% 40% write parallel program 39 39 44 29 44 41 improve basic model 41 44 54 58 51 49 debug 32 30 31 29 28 31 tune performance 31 22 30 33 31 29 set up program runs 43 38 48 33 38 44 Tables 4 and 5 contrast the origins of the tools used for each program development activity. The percentages in Table4 reflect the proportion of respondents who use tools supplied by outside sources (either commercial or in the public domain), while those in Table 5 indicate the use of tools developed personally or by someone else within the respondent apos;s organization. These categories are not mutually exclusive; that is, some respondents report using tools from both types of sources.... In PAGE 9: ... In cases where there are significant differences between scientist and engineer responses, the two are distinguished. As can be appreciated in Table4 , quot;external quot; tools are used most frequently for debugging and tuning, followed closely by modifications to the serial program. Web wrapper agents The information required to answer the questions about the 13 decision points in the decision tree is available; however, it is spread over a variety of online sequence databases and analytical tools. Table2 presents the databases and analytical tools used by FASTSNP for SNP prioritization and other func- tions. A traditional approach to integrating external sources is to download all the required data and programs and implement a huge data warehouse, but this often runs into maintenance difficulties because all the data must be kept up-to-date (11).... ..."
